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Gnocchi

    In a large pot of salted boiling water, cook the potato gnocchi according to package instructions until they float to the surface (about 2-4 minutes). Drain and set aside.

  2. 2

    Make the Pomodoro Sauce

    In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ant, being careful not to burn it.

  3. 3

    Add Tomatoes

    Add the canned whole tomatoes (crushing them with your hands as you add) to the skillet. Stir in salt and black pepper. Let it simmer for about 10-15 minutes.

  4. 4

    Combine Gnocchi and Sauce

    Once the sauce has thickened, add the cooked gnocchi to the skillet and gently toss to combine. Add fresh basil leaves and stir for another 2 minutes.

  5. 5

    Serve

    Plate the gnocchi pomodoro and sprinkle with grated Parmesan cheese before serving.
